웬디의 기묘한 이야기

글 작성자: WENDYS
반응형

젯슨 나노 전원모드 변경하여 최대 성능으로 사용하기

젯슨 나노(Jetson Nano)에는 두가지 전원 모드가 존재합니다. Micro USB 전원을 이용한 5W 모드와 5V 아답타를 이용한 10W모드를 각각 설정할 수 있습니다. 기본은 5W 모드이니 5V 아답타를 이용하는경우 모드를 변경하여 최대 성능으로 사용하면 조금 더 빠른 성능으로 사용이 가능합니다.

전원모드를 변경하기 전에는 YOLOv3 처리시간이 600ms정도가 걸린 반면 최대 성능 모드로 변경하니 450ms로 차이를 보였으며, 멀티 thread를 통해 여러개를 동시에 돌렸을 때 절약 모드에서는 시간이 2배로 증가하였으나, 최대 성능 모드에서는 약간만 증가한것을 확인할 수 있었습니다.

 

현재 모드 확인하기

j@j:~$ sudo nvpmodel -q
NVPM WARN: fan mode is not set!
NV Power Mode: MAXN
0

저는 현재 최대 성능 모드를 사용중이기떄문에 MAXN 으로 설정된것을 확인할 수 있습니다.

 

최대성능 10W 모드 사용하기

j@j:~$ sudo nvpmodel -m0

j@j:~$ sudo nvpmodel -q
NVPM WARN: fan mode is not set!
NV Power Mode: MAXN
0

sudo nvpmodel -m0 으로 설정하면 젯슨의 성능을 최대로 발휘할 수 있는 모드로 설정됩니다.

다만, 최대성능은 5V 4A의 아답타를 연결해야하며, 그렇지 않으면 전원이 자주 꺼지는것을 경험할 수 있습니다.

그리고 5V 아답타 연결시 J48 점퍼를 연결해주어야 전원을 사용할 수 있습니다.

 

절약모드 5W 모드 사용하기

j@j:~$ sudo nvpmodel -m1

j@j:~$ sudo nvpmodel -q
NVPM WARN: fan mode is not set!
NV Power Mode: 5W
1

sudo nvpmodel -m1 으로 설정하면 Micro USB에서도 사용할 수 있는 최저 전력모드로 사용할 수 있습니다.

해당 모드는 외장 베터리를 연결해도 사용할 수 있으며, J48 점퍼가 연결되어있으면 전원이 켜지지 않습니다.

 

 

반응형